Anzahl Zeilen in leerem editierbarem Table Control

Benutzeroberflächen in SAP Systemen.

Anzahl Zeilen in leerem editierbarem Table Control

Postby Yara1503 » Mon Oct 24, 2011 7:46 pm

Hallo,

ich habe ein Dynpro in dem alle Felder erstmal auf nicht editierbar gesetzt sind.
Durch Klick auf den Button "Ändern" werden dynamisch die Felder auf screen-input=1 gesetzt welche editierbar sein sollen.

Bei einem TableControl, dass schon mindestens eine Zeile enthält werden nur die Felder der vorhandenen Zeilen eingabebereit gemacht. Neue Zeilen können nur über den vom Wizzard generierten Button (mit dem grünen Plus drauf) eingefügt werden.

Habe ich aber ein TableControl, dass gar keine Zeile enthält werden alle Zeilen eingabebereit.

Ist das Standardverhalten?
Ich würde mir eher wünschen, dass im zweiten Fall alle Zeilen grau bleiben und man über den entsprechenden Button neue Zeilen einfügen kann.

Gibt es eine Lösung für mein Problem?
Yara1503
..
..
 
Posts: 18
Joined: Mon Apr 25, 2011 11:30 pm

Re: Anzahl Zeilen in leerem editierbarem Table Control

Postby Jonny2227 » Tue Oct 25, 2011 8:00 am

Sali,

prüfe doch - bevor du die Felder Eingabebereit machst - ob deine interne Tabelle überhaupt Daten enthält und wenn nicht - dann nimmst du die interne Tabelle / den TC aus dem Screen Modify raus.

Gruss Jens
Jonny2227
....
....
 
Posts: 605
Joined: Wed Mar 01, 2006 3:16 pm

Re: Anzahl Zeilen in leerem editierbarem Table Control

Postby Yara1503 » Tue Oct 25, 2011 12:57 pm

Danke, so hab ichs jetzt gemacht.

Manche Lösungen sind so einfach, dass man erst gar nicht drauf kommt...
Yara1503
..
..
 
Posts: 18
Joined: Mon Apr 25, 2011 11:30 pm


Return to Dialogprogrammierung

Who is online

Users browsing this forum: No registered users and 6 guests